SnipeSquad NQ-Survival Sniper

Rapid-fire scalping toolkit for the 1-minute CME Nasdaq-100 futures chart (NQ/MNQ) that stacks a higher-time-frame trend bias, intraday VWAP, and momentum/RSI triggers, then auto-maps stop & target levels so $nipeSquad members can drop OCO orders in a click.
What the script does
• Context filter – Pulls a 34-EMA from a higher time-frame (default 15 min) and checks where price sits versus that EMA and the current-session VWAP.
o Price > EMA and VWAP ⇒ bullish context
o Price < EMA and VWAP ⇒ bearish context
• Entry trigger – On the 1-minute chart it waits for:
o an 8/21 EMA crossover / cross-under, plus
o an RSI sanity check (RSI < 60 for longs, > 40 for shorts).
• Risk template – You define the risk per trade in ticks (default 20).
o Script instantly projects a stop and a target at your chosen Reward-to-Risk multiple (default 2 R).
o Each new trade is tagged with an ID label that shows direction and tick target so you can fire an OCO order fast.
• Visual outputs
o VWAP line (session-reset) and Higher-TF EMA line
o Green/red triangles for entries
o Up/down labels that display the projected target price
• Alerts ready – alertcondition() lines fire the moment a long or short signal prints, so you can route them to a broker, Discord, or wherever the $nipeSquad hangs out.
Adjustable inputs
Input Default Purpose
Context TF 15 (min) Higher-time-frame used for trend bias
Risk (ticks) 20 Size of the stop in ticks
Reward-to-Risk 2.0 Multiplier that sets the profit target
VWAP session / UTC 1800-1600 / UTC-4 Lets you anchor VWAP to your preferred trading session
How to use
1. Add the script on a 1-minute NQ or MNQ chart.
2. Set your risk ticks so the dollar value lines up with your prop-firm rules or personal risk limits.
3. Wait for a triangle that aligns with your bias; the label shows stop & target prices.
4. Place an OCO order (or link an automation) using those levels.
5. Repeat until daily goal is hit, or your risk plan says stop.
